About this work

Geological context: Permian, Word Fm. Collection locality: fourth ls, NE of Word Ranch house, Glass Mountains, west TX, Brewster County, Texas, USA. Collected by Robert E. King. IP number 37651; lot count 2; accn=YPM.03892.
